Despite criticism Spuerkeess will not hire former Fortuna Bank employees

According to the government's response to a recent parliamentary question, Spuerkeess does not plan to take over Fortuna Bank employees.

MPs Laurent Mosar and Marc Spautz from the Christian Social People’s Party (CSV) submitted the question to Minister of Finance Yuriko Backes after the Luxembourg Association of Bank and Insurance Employees (Aleba) accused Spuerkeess of helping Fortuna Bank clients but not employees.

In her response, Backes stresses that the government does not intervene in the commercial activities of Spuerkess (the state is the bank’s sole shareholder). According to Backes, Spuerkess has informed the Ministry of Finance that solutions for staff members are being prepared, but by Fortuna Bank itself.

Spuerkess makes “commercial offers” to Fortuna Bank clients, which the latter may accept or decline.

Fortuna Bank has decided to phase out its operations in the Grand Duchy. At the moment, the bank still employs about 30 workers.
